Warning Signs You Need raised decking

  • Boards that flex, bounce or creak when you walk across the deck
  • Green algae or black staining on the surface
  • Split, cupped or splintering boards that catch bare feet
  • Screw heads lifting above the board surface
  • Wobbly handrails or balustrade posts on a raised section
  • A patchy, peeling finish where the old treatment has worn through

How long does raised decking take?

Most raised decking jobs take 4–10 days on site. Wet weather and waiting for footings to firm up or difficult access through the house can add time, so ask the installer for a start-to-finish plan.

Do I need planning permission for decking in Welshpool?

Many ground-level decks in England fall under permitted development, but decks more than 30cm above the ground usually need consent. Listed buildings, flats and some conservation areas have extra restrictions, and rules differ in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land, so check with the council covering Welshpool before building.

Should I choose timber or composite decking?

Timber is usually cheaper to buy and install but needs an oil or stain every year or two. Composite boards cost more at the start and avoid most of the yearly upkeep. An installer can show samples of both before you decide.

Decisions to settle before the work is priced

A line of posts is not a complete structural design. Ground conditions influence the footings; spans and loads influence beams and joists; connections and bracing resist movement. Stair openings and balustrade posts introduce further forces. Significant height, unusual geometry or uncertain ground may call for an engineer’s design.

Photograph the slope from safe ground and explain how the garden is currently reached. Tell the designer about intended heavy items, including large planters or a hot tub, before loads are specified. An ordinary domestic deck should not be assumed capable of carrying a filled hot tub.

From assessment to completion in Welshpool

  • Measure the drop across the site and mark out the platform, stairs and landings.
  • Resolve planning, building control and structural design questions before construction.
  • Form suitable foundations while checking for buried services at excavation points.
  • Assemble the load-bearing frame and its restraints to the agreed design.
  • Fit decking, stair components and guarding as a coordinated system.
  • Complete any agreed sign-off stages and leave the site tidy with care information.

Checks before booking in Welshpool

Do not assume a deck is exempt just because it is made of wood or composite. Read the Planning Portal guidance for decking in England and check the rules for the actual address. Height, footprint, position and property restrictions all matter; UK nations have different regimes. Powys County Council can help you identify the appropriate local authority guidance.

For decks requiring planning permission in England, Planning Portal building regulations advice says building regulations should be assumed to apply. Confirm the design and inspection requirements with building control, particularly for elevated structures.

Looking after the result in Welshpool

Keep access to visible supports where the design allows, so changes can be noticed. Report new movement, loose guarding or deteriorating connections promptly and stop using suspect areas. A fresh coat on the boards does not address weakness below them.

The service guide allows approximately 4–10 days of work. Discuss the elapsed programme too, as waiting for supplies, drying or approvals can extend it.

Does the board material change the planning position?

Using timber or composite does not by itself settle permission. The height, position, property and local rules need checking. Establish the position with the relevant planning authority before construction.

Can a hot tub stand on a raised deck?

Only where the structure has been designed for the actual loaded weight and its distribution. Give the designer the proposed equipment details before the frame is specified; do not assume a normal seating deck is adequate.

Who should organise the structural design?

Agree that responsibility before accepting the quote. The installer may coordinate a designer or engineer, or you may appoint one separately. The construction proposal needs to follow the resulting design and any required approvals.
